Para comenzar a aprender cualquier lenguaje de programación, hay una serie de
conceptos e ideas que son necesarias.
El objetivo de este capítulo es presentarle el vocabulario básico de la programación y algunos de los fundamentales
Buques de construcción de Python.
PPI les proporciona la transcripción del video anterior, traducida al español
Hola y bienvenido al primero screencast para el capítulo 2 en este capítulo.
Tenemos mucho material básico para presentarte de hecho, en su mayoría mucho es vocabulario, así que si vamos a hablar entre sí como la computadora científicos tenemos que comenzar a aprender cómo
hablar el mismo idioma y así vamos a Comience con algunos de los fundamentos Lo primero que necesitamos saber es que una de las cosas fundamentales al estar trabajando con Python se llama
valor un valor puede ser como un número o una palabra y de hecho a menudo consulte estos valores o como objetos y Muchas veces usaremos la palabra de valor y objeto indistintamente y tal vez uno
de las primeras y más importantes cosas es decir y algo que nos escuchará decir una y otra vez es que en Python todo es un objeto bien Entonces estos objetos se clasifican en diferentes tipos de cosas a veces Llame a la forma en que clasificamos Objetos en Python los llamamos clases A veces los llamamos tipos de datos De nuevo, esos son dos justas palabras intercambiables y lo haremos
Llegaremos a los puntos más finos de uno que podría decir uno versus otro más adelante en el curso está bien ahora si queremos Descubre qué tipo de qué tipo de cosa.
Un objeto Python particular es que podemos Solo usa Python para decirnos que directamente
Hacer uso de una función llamada Tipo (type) función para que pueda ver aquí en este Ejemplo vamos a imprimir el tipo de hello world y vamos a Imprimir el tipo del número 17 y Entonces solo vamos a imprimir hola Mundo, así que si hago clic en el botón Ejecutar allí Verás que nos dice que esta cadena hola mundo está en la clase string (cadena de texto) tipo str y Este número 17 es la clase int(entero) de pie para entero en Python y todos Lenguajes de programación realmente hacemos una distinción entre lo que llamamos enteros y números de puntos flotantes y la distinción básica de una sintáctica.
El punto de vista es solo que enteros no tienen ningún punto decimal en ellos Son solo los números enteros, como tú aprendí sobre en la clase aritmética todos los números son enteros. Esto es correcto
si tenemos un número aquí que está con un punto decimal, veremos que Python nos dice que eso es parte de la clase flotante, float todo ahora mismo aquí hay un poco más.
>>print(type("hola mundo"))
>>>class str
>>print(type(17))
>>>class int
>>print(type(17.0))
>>>class float
>>print(type("17"))
>>>class str
Ejemplo difícil, de aviso cuando ejecuto esto lo dice revolver y revolver y podrías pensar sobre eso por solo un segundo por qué Digamos que ambos son cadenas ("hola mundo" y "17") y La respuesta es que porque si tu lo notamos o no nos rodeamos cosas que parecían números con las comillas, está bien, así es como distinguimos una cadena en Python es poniendo comillas alrededor de él de hecho para crear una cadena puedes usar comillas simples (' '), puedes usar comillas dobles (" "), o puedes usar comillas triples (''' '''), y hay varias razones para que una de las cosas que surgen a menudo; es que escribiendo una cadena que quizás necesites, incluye una cita simple si vas para poner si vas a usar uno solo cita como apóstrofe, entonces lo harías rodea tu cadena general con comillas dobles si vas a tener una cadena donde ibas a tal vez citar a alguien y querer eso en doble comillas entonces tendrías la cadena rodeado de comillas simples y finalmente en Python si queremos tener una cadena.
Ese es un mensaje que incluso puede transmitirse, varias líneas podemos usar comillas triples
ya sea de nuevo ya sea comillas dobles triples o comillas simples triples, entonces aquí hay un ejemplo donde hemos rodeado Nuestra cadena general con comillas triples, Porque ambos estamos citando a alguien """oh, No, Exclamó que la bicicleta de Ben está rota""", estamos citándola nuevamente, pero en este caso estamos también usando un apóstrofe en el medio de nuestra cita así como nosotros a medida que nos movemos a lo largo verá muchos de muchos diferentes Ejemplos de cadenas.
Bueno un par de un par de cosas más para mantener en la mente es que es muy importante no Piense que puede usar comas en sus cadenas, que no son un entero legal de hecho Si hacemos esto, verás algo muy extraño, así que solo Recuerde que no hay comas en sus números largos.
Está bien, otra cosa importante es pensar sobre cambiar un tipo a otro tipo y entonces tenemos algunas funciones que Podemos usar para convertir un valor particular a un otro particular valor y esas cosas pasan, el mismo nombre que hemos visto hasta ahora puede convertir algo a un int usando la función int y puedes ver que la función int aquí podemos convertir algo a un flotador usando el float funciona y verás que allí y podemos convertir algo en un revuelo cuerda usando la función de agitación, de modo que si solo tómate un minuto y ejecuta estos ejemplos verás que en este primero caso obtenemos un error porque esto no puede convertir a un número entero 23 botellas en para convertir algo en un
entero solo debe contener alfanumérico solo tiene solo puede contener caracteres numéricos que no puede contener caracteres de cadena que no puede contener letras.
entero solo debe contener alfanumérico solo tiene solo puede contener caracteres numéricos que no puede contener caracteres de cadena que no puede contener letras.
Bien, así que si llegamos miramos al otro ejemplos que puedes ver podemos convertir 3.14 en 3 y lo hace redondeando En todos los casos, tres, punto nueve nueve nueve, se convierte en un entero de tres 3.0 se convierte a tres y así sucesivamente en este caso nuestro punto flotante número que estamos convirtiendo la cadena uno a tres puntos cuatro cinco en un real flotante y puedes ver ambos flotantes
número de puntos y el tipo de él allí y aquí podemos ver que podemos convertir a cualquier número
en una cadena y podemos verificar su tipo Está bien, para resumir esta pequeña lección Realmente hemos introducido tres importantes tipos de datos que usaremos a lo largo de la clase enteros flotando
puntos y cuerdas que hemos visto cómo podemos Crear cadenas usando cotizaciones dobles
citas individuales o un grupo triple de comillas y hemos visto cómo puede convertir un tipo de datos en otro Usando algún tipo de funciones de conversión.
No hay comentarios.:
Publicar un comentario